For present and past members of the Railway Protection Force (RPF) or Railway Protection Special Force (RPSF) who are not gazetted officials, the Prime Minister’s Scholarship Scheme for the Ministry of Railways 2025–2026 provides financial assistance to them. Higher technical and professional education is the program’s goal in these wards. The selected pupils will get a stipend of ₹3,000 per month for female students and ₹2,500 per month for male students. Purpose of the Prime Minister Scholarship Scheme for the Ministry of Railways
The main purpose of the Prime Minister’s Scholarship Scheme for the Ministry of Railways is to give current and past members of the Railway Protection Force (RPF) and Railway Protection Special Force (RPSF) financial help for additional technical and professional education. In particular, the initiative aims to provide financial assistance so that these people can enroll in degree programs in fields including engineering, medicine, management, etc. The program’s objective is to support widows or dependent wards (children) of RPF/RPSF members who are not gazetted officers. Through enrollment in various professional degree programs, the scholarship aims to assist these persons in completing their higher education.

Eligibility Criteria
- The candidates must be widows or dependent wards (children) of current or former members of the Railway Protection Force (RPF) or Railway Protection Special Force (RPSF) who applied for the PMSS during the same academic year and were below the rank of Gazetted Officer.
- At least 60% of the applicant’s points in their Minimum Entry Qualification (MEQ), such as a Class 12 diploma, graduation, or diploma, should have been earned.
- Professional degree programs (BE, B.Tech, BDS, MBBS, Bed, LLB, BCA, MCA, B.Pharma, etc.) are being pursued by the aspirants.
- The relevant government regulatory agencies, such as the AICTE, MCI, UGC, or NCTE, should approve the application.

Financial Benefits
- Monthly scholarships of Rs. 3000 and Rs. 2500 would be given to the girl and boy students, respectively, under this program.
Required Documents
- Aadhar card,
- A bona fide certificate, and
- Previous grade reports
- When applying under PMSS, the applicant must upload or present service certificates issued by the relevant category.
- A copy of a book of categories, a PPO, or a discharge certificate.
- Candidates must attach a scanned copy of their MEQ grade card.
No of Scholarship
- The government has chosen to offer scholarships to 150 students as part of this initiative. This scholarship will be awarded for two to five years.

Prime Minister Scholarship Scheme For the Ministry Of Railways Apply Online
To apply online for this program, you must follow the steps listed below:
- Step 1: To begin the online application process, go to the Program’s NSP website and click the “Apply Now” option below.

- Step 2: Click the “Register” button and fill out the required registration details. Note: To log in if you have previously registered, use your Gmail account, email address, or cellphone number.

- Step 3: Find and choose the “Students” option located on the left-hand side of the dashboard.
- Step 4: You must click the “Login” button under the OTR option in order to apply for a scholarship on the National Scholarship Portal (NSP).
- Step 5: Choose “New user.” On the left side of the dashboard, click the “Register yourself” button.
- Step 6: After carefully reviewing the information and checking the box, click “Next.”
- Step 7: Enter a functional mobile number, an OTP, and a captcha code to complete the registration process.
- Step 8: Click “Save & Register” after filling out the required information to finish the “One-time registration (OTR)” procedure. (Note: In order to complete the OTR process, students must download the OTR mobile application for face authentication; this is a temporary registration number.)
- Step 9: After successfully registering, choose the “Apply for Scholarship” option and click the “Login” button.
- Step 10: Select the scholarship, fill out the application, include the necessary files, and send it in.
